Your claim would enjoy been remunerated under your twelve-monthly physical, but a ultrasound is not a routine procedure for an annual exam. Most annuals include, pap smear, blood work and mammogram.
Since your doctor was looking for something because of a symptom, it wouldn't be rewarded under your annual physical. If your insurance compensated for everything else associated with this drop by, I think you might hold to pay.
It would seem to be, going by what you have stated, "because of some issues," that the ultrasound be ordered because of a possible existing medical condition. It was not ordered as chunk of your annual gynecological exam, therefore the ultrasound would be subject to the annual deductible.
